A suspect currently on the wanted list of law enforcement agencies in Ogun State has been spotted in Saki, Oyo State.

This development was revealed in a memo by Sunday Odukoya, the Executive Assistant on Security to Governor Seyi Makinde of Oyo State.

In the memo addressed to the Commandant of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ps (NSCDC), he urged the security agencies to tighten security in strategic locations across the state.

He also noted that key locations must be closely guarded by security personnel. Some of these include the governor’s office/government house, government installations, all schools, recreation centres, banks, bus terminals/garages, churches/mosques, security barracks/stations.

“Information received from the Commandant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ps revealed that One BOYI ACTOR ‘M’ who is on wanted list of Ogun State and others States in Nigeria was sighted in a Black Tinted Car though the make and model of the car is yet to be received from the Author.

“The suspect sighted in Saki town Oyo State. This means that, the suspect coming to Oyo State is to pave way for members of his group from Niger. Kwara, and Kaduna States. It is necessary to quickly activate your security methodology along the Exits/inlet points into the State.

“More so, the following are to be concentrated on: Governor’s Office/Government House Government Installations All Schools (Universities/Secondary/Primary Schools) Recreation Centres Banks Bus Terminals/Garages Churches/Mosques Security Barracks/Stations.

“Finally, visibility of security operatives and vehicle patrol system should be enforced,” the memo read.
